Battle Bound Warhound: Ultimate Guide & Strategies

The battle bound warhound represents a new standard in tactical mobility and resilient design for security operations and field teams. Engineered for demanding environments, this platform balances speed, protection, and modular payload options.

Deployed by specialized units and private security providers, the battle bound warhound combines hardened components with intuitive controls to maintain operational tempo under stress. Teams rely on its predictable behavior when conditions deteriorate rapidly.

Mobility and Terrain Adaptation

Designed for rapid repositioning across mixed terrain, the battle bound warhound uses adaptive suspension and traction control to preserve grip on gravel, mud, and urban surfaces. Drivers can switch between modes to optimize responsiveness or stability without stopping.

The low center of mass and reinforced undercarriage reduce rollover risk on uneven routes, while large-format tires help absorb shock and maintain cabin comfort during long-distance patrols. This focus on mobility keeps teams ahead of evolving threats.

Payload and Mission Configuration

Operators treat the battle bound warhound as a modular platform, able to support communications suites, medical stations, or light weapons mounts with minimal downtime. Quick-release fittings allow teams to change equipment packs in the field.

Internal volume is optimized for both personnel and cargo, enabling the same vehicle to conduct personnel insertion, equipment transport, or border patrol with simple reconfiguration. Standardized rails and anchor points simplify integration with mission-specific hardware.

Operational Reliability and Support

Each battle bound warhound undergoes endurance testing under extreme temperatures, dust loads, and continuous vibration to validate long-term reliability. The goal is to minimize breakdowns when teams are operating far from base.

Authorized service centers provide scheduled inspections, software updates, and component upgrades backed by regional parts inventories. This support network ensures that units maintain high availability even in remote areas.

FAQ

Reader questions

What maintenance schedule is recommended for the battle bound warhound in continuous field use?

Perform daily visual inspections, oil changes every 100 operating hours, and full mechanical service at 500 hours or quarterly, whichever comes first under sustained operations.

Can the vehicle be equipped with additional armor without affecting mobility?

Yes, modular armor kits are available and tested to preserve handling; however, operators should verify payload limits and rebalance ballast when maximum protection is selected.

How does the hybrid power pack version perform in cold weather environments? The hybrid system includes battery thermal management and engine block heaters, enabling reliable starts below −20°C while maintaining normal power output once warmed. Are aftermarket electronics integrations supported by the manufacturer?

Integration support is available through certified partners, with documented wiring harnesses, data ports, and secure mounting solutions that preserve original warranty coverage.
